
Two Journalists Sentenced in Maldives for Reporting on President's Alleged Affair
🤖AI Özeti
Two journalists in the Maldives have been sentenced to jail for breaching a gag order related to allegations against President Mohamed Muizzu. This incident has drawn condemnation from various rights groups, highlighting concerns over press freedom in the country. The case underscores the ongoing tension between the government and media, particularly regarding sensitive political issues.
